While many people believe there should be more gun control and the possibility of banning guns all together, I believe the gun control laws should not be changed. Although there are many reasons that may persuade people to choose to ban guns, I believe that there are several other reasons that lead to all the tragedies with guns in America. Banning guns is not an answer the gun problem in America. There are a few other things that could be done to stop gun violence. I will tell why I believe gun control laws should not be changed.
After the many shootings in schools over the past ten years, many people believe guns should be made illegal for civilians to possess or purchase. While this would make it very difficult for minors, drug addicts, and people with mental deficiencies to get hold on a gun, The Constitution allows all citizens to possess arms to defend themselves, their families', and their property. However if guns were made illegal, people would still be able smuggle guns. If a burglar were to smuggle a gun in to someone's home, that man or woman should be allowed to possess a gun to defend their self.   And if guns were illegal, mostly only people who do not abide the law would smuggle them, leaving all the law-abiding citizens unarmed and more prone to attack with a gun.
